In 2020-2021, 990 people earned their degree in animal services, making the major the 271st most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, animal services gra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$22,249 and had an average of $17,877 in loans still to pay off.

Across Colorado, there were 113 animal services graduates with average earnings and debt of $25,239 and $22,500 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 61 animal services gra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,670 and $29,027 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Colorado State University - Fort Collins.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Most Veteran Friendly in Colorado for Animal Services for a Bachelor’s list. Colorado State is located in Fort Collins, Colorado and, has a large student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 61 bachelors’s animal services degrees to qualified students.

Colorado State did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Animal Services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Colorado” list.Our most recent data shows that 1,606 of the 32,428 students enrolled at Colorado State were GI Bill® students, of which 1,183 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$10,701. In addition to receiving other benefits, 68 students received funds through the Yellow Ribbon Program. Students may be able to receive credit for their military training, depending on their background.
